Smoking For Jesus football continues winning streak

The Smoking For Jesus football team didn’t need late rallies to defeat San Antonio Jubilee Oct. 21, winning 55-6 in a contest that ended with six minutes left in the third quarter. The Eagles (4-5, 2-0) earned their third win in a row. “We’re on a great winning streak,” defensive coordinator Boo Maxwell said. “The boys are learning and gelling together more and more as we get closer to the playoffs. Burnet football’s rally falls short against Canyon Lake

CAPTION: Burnet junior linebacker Trenton Park tackles Canyon Lake senior Helijah Johnson for a loss Oct. 21. Photo by Martelle Luedecke/Luedecke Photography The Burnet High School football team lost to Canyon Lake 28-14 Oct. 21 in a District 13-4A Division I match-up. The score was tied at 7-7 at the end of the first quarter. Burnet volleyball continues pursuit of undefeated district record with two more wins

CAPTION: Burnet senior Addie Grace Hernandez (front row, left) and junior MaeSyn Gay hold posters proclaiming their big accomplishments for the Lady Dawgs following the victory against Marble Falls Oct. 18. Courtesy photo The Burnet High School volleyball team earned two more District 24-4A victories against rivals Marble Falls and Lampasas. Middle School football: Marble Falls takes two from Burnet

CAPTION: The Marble Falls seventh-grade A team gathers for post-game congratulations from their coaches after beating Burnet. Staff photo by Jennifer Fierro Marble Falls Middle School welcomed Burnet to Pony Stadium Oct. 13. The Marble Falls seventh-grade A team won 32-12 and the eighth-graders also won 6-0, while the Burnet seventh-grade B team earned the 14-0 win. Burnet football defeats Marble Falls for district win

CAPTION: The Burnet defense limited the Marble Falls slot-T offense led the way to victory. Photo by Martelle Luedecke/Luedecke Photography The Burnet High School football team beat Marble Falls 28-14 Oct. 14 for its first win in District 13-4A Division I play. The Bulldogs (4-3, 1-1) romped to victory thanks to a strong rushing attack led by juniors Dash Denton and Grant Jones.
